Armed with bold acumen and a Ph.D. in Media Psychology, Singleton has her finger on the pulse of how culture and technology impact the human experience. Rather than merely analyzing fan engagement, Singleton architects it and has both shared her expert insights and advised major organizations and outlets including the NHL, Warner Media, Peabody Awards, and America’s Funniest Home Videos, and has been spotlighted by Vogue, Wired, Bleacher Report, ESPN, and The Athletic.
Her work at the intersection of media, communications, culture, and psychology transforms passive spectators into devoted superfans through her research-backed approach to messaging.
As President of the Board of Directors for Black Girl Hockey Club, she champions access and opportunity in sports culture. In 2024, she was honored as a Salzburg Global Fellow for her leadership in addressing global challenges, and as Professor at UNLV and Howard University, her teaching philosophy empowers youth with leadership development and real-world critical thinking skills.
